Your First Visit

When you book your first appointment you will be sent a Welcome Pack. This contains information about the practice and includes a medical history questionnaire which we ask you to complete and bring with you to your first appointment. This is to ensure that your care is tailored to take account of any medical conditions you may have.

We ask for a deposit for the new patient appointment booking and this will be discounted against the cost of the first appointment that you attend.

An important part of your first appointment will be to take the opportunity to talk to you about your dental health concerns, and for us to provide you with the information you need in order to begin evaluating your treatment choices, and deciding on your preferred options. These will be based on your concerns, needs, values and priorities.

Regardless of the services you seek, each new patient will have a full clinical examination to evaluate the status of their dental health. We will then discuss a range of treatment options, including cost.

Things you could bring to your first appointment:

  • The completed medical history questionnaire.
  • Information about any complex dental treatment previously received.
  • Any x-rays you may previously have had. (this may reduce the number of subsequent x-rays required.)

It is important to note that more complex cases will require more extensive record taking to allow greater deliberation and evaluation of alternatives prior to deciding on a treatment plan.

Occasionally treatment plans develop over time. As priorities and opportunities change, careful and flexible planning allows long term care to be built on firm foundations.

 Treatment Plans

Having made an informed choice about your treatment plan, you will be given an estimate of the cost. You will normally pay for treatment as each item is completed.

A deposit may be required for more complex items involving several stages and laboratory work.

How long will my treatment take?

Having decided on a course of dental treatment, the dentist will be able to advise you how long the treatment is likely to take and a clear idea of costing. Should the treatment plan change your dentist will be able to advise you on the clinical and cost implications.

At the end of the treatment plan your dentist will discuss with you a suitable review / examination period. For most patients this will be six months.

What will my treatment cost?

Written estimates are given for all treatment plans, and if at any stage you are unsure about costing, please ask our reception staff or your dentist for an update. An outline price list is held at our reception and you are free to ask for a copy.

We ask for 24 hours notice fort the cancellation of booked appointments. For late cancelled or missed appointments there will be a charge.
